Mazda MX-5 Miata NA

Mazda MX-5 Miata NA

The Mazda MX-5 Miata NA is the quintessential lightweight tuner roadster—extremely light, mechanically simple, and supported by the largest aftermarket, making it the most cost-effective platform for high-output engine swaps. Compared to the NB, MR2, 240Z, and S2000 it typically offers the lowest acquisition and installation costs and the fewest packaging headaches, so builders can reach high power with minimal chassis surgery.

Mazda MX-5 Miata NB

Mazda MX-5 Miata NB

The Mazda MX-5 Miata NB retains the NA’s lightweight chassis while adding improved suspension geometry and friendlier wiring, making it a stable foundation for turbocharged or small-block swaps without a major step up in budget. It strikes a balance between the bargain NA and pricier platforms like the S2000 or restored 240Z by offering better parts availability and slightly more creature comforts that simplify street-focused high-output builds.

Datsun 240Z

Datsun 240Z

The Datsun 240Z offers a classic roadster package with a roomy engine bay and strong vintage aftermarket for L-series and modern crate engine conversions, making it an excellent choice when big displacement or period-correct power is desired. Although generally more susceptible to rust and often pricier to buy and restore than Miatas or MR2s, its collectible status can preserve or grow value for well-executed, high-output swaps compared with rapidly depreciating tuner platforms.

Toyota MR2 SW20

Toyota MR2 SW20

The Toyota MR2 SW20’s mid-engine layout provides exceptional weight distribution and handling potential for high-output swaps, and it pairs especially well with Toyota turbo hardware (3S-GTE or modern 2JZ/1JZ adaptations) for compact, powerful conversions. Swaps are technically more complex and often costlier than on front-engine Miatas due to packaging, cooling, and exhaust routing, but a properly engineered MR2 delivers a uniquely balanced, track-capable roadster that outperforms many front-engine rivals.

Honda S2000 AP1

Honda S2000 AP1

The Honda S2000 AP1 is the most performance-ready stock platform here, featuring a high-revving F20C, superior chassis stiffness, and modern brakes—traits that reduce the scope of supporting upgrades for high-output builds. While market prices are typically higher than Miatas, MR2s, or an unrestored 240Z, the S2000’s advanced engineering and durable drivetrain can deliver a higher reliable power ceiling that justifies the premium for serious tuners.

Why Lightweight Chassis and High Power Work Together

A lightweight chassis paired with a high-output engine improves overall performance by enhancing acceleration, braking, and cornering. The benefits are supported by vehicle dynamics principles and applied motorsport research, which show that reducing mass and optimizing stiffness and suspension geometry yields more predictable handling and faster lap times, often with lower peak horsepower requirements than heavier platforms. For beginners, the core idea is simple: less weight and a rigid, well-tuned chassis let the engine and tires deliver usable power more effectively.

Power-to-weight ratio is a primary predictor of straight-line acceleration; reducing mass often gives bigger gains than the same percentage increase in power.

Chassis stiffness and reinforced mounting points allow suspension geometry to work as intended, improving tire contact and repeatable handling.

Lower rotational and unsprung mass improves transient response, meaning the car changes direction and recovers faster after inputs.

Tire grip, cooling, and suspension tuning are often the limiting factors; research and SAE technical papers emphasize holistic upgrades, not just more horsepower.

Practical studies in motorsport engineering recommend incremental testing and dyno/chassis measurements to balance power upgrades with brakes, cooling, and safety systems.

Conclusion

In Canada, these five used roadster platforms offer strong foundations for lightweight, high-output swaps: Mazda MX-5 Miata NA, Mazda MX-5 Miata NB, Datsun 240Z, Toyota MR2 SW20, and Honda S2000 AP1. For most builders seeking the simplest, lightest, and best-supported platform, the Mazda MX-5 Miata NA stands out as the best overall choice thanks to its exceptionally low weight, huge aftermarket, and well understood swap paths. The NB is a close alternative with more modern amenities, while the Datsun 240Z offers classic presence and a stout chassis, the MR2 SW20 brings mid-engine balance at the cost of complexity, and the Honda S2000 AP1 delivers a high-revving drivetrain with strong factory components.
